[Accessibility of paramedical training institutes to students with disabilities]
1Pôle des métiers du soin, Crip Ugecam Occitanie, 435 avenue Georges-Frêche, CS 10010, 34173 Castelnau-le-Lez, France.
Abstract:
The Nursing Training Institute and the Caregivers Training Institute at the Reeducation and Professional Integration Centre of the Union for the management of the Health Insurance Funds Occitanie train students with disabilities to become skilled professionals. Their expertise highlights the levers and obstacles that prevent disabled students from entering the care professions.

Specialized Care Centers and Settings-II
Rural health centers are specialized care facilities in remote locations with very few medical personnel. The primary care providers who run the centers are mostly Registered Nurse Practitioners. Here, emergency treatment is provided to critically ill or injured patients before they are transferred to the closest hospital.
